My Buying Guides on Hood With Hood Scoop

What I Look for First

When I shop for a hood with a hood scoop, I first think about why I want it. For me, it is not just about style. I want the scoop to match my vehicle, improve airflow if needed, and fit properly without causing installation issues. I always start by checking whether I want a functional scoop or a purely decorative one.

Fitment and Vehicle Compatibility

One of the most important things I consider is fitment. I make sure the hood is designed for my exact make, model, and year. A hood scoop that looks great but does not align correctly can create more problems than it solves. I also check whether the hood requires modifications, because I prefer a product that fits cleanly with minimal extra work.

Material Quality

I pay close attention to the material because it affects durability, weight, and appearance. Common materials include fiberglass, carbon fiber, steel, and aluminum. If I want a lightweight upgrade, I usually look at carbon fiber or fiberglass. If I want strength and a more factory-style feel, I consider steel or aluminum. The material also affects how well the hood handles weather and daily driving.

Functional vs. Decorative Scoop

I always decide whether I need a functional scoop or just the look of one. A functional scoop can help direct air into the engine bay or intake system, which may improve performance in some setups. A decorative scoop mainly changes the appearance of the vehicle. I make this choice based on my driving needs, not just style.

Design and Style

I want the hood scoop to match the overall look of my vehicle. Some scoops are aggressive and race-inspired, while others are subtle and factory-looking. I usually choose a design that complements the body lines of my car or truck. If the scoop looks too large or out of place, it can take away from the vehicle’s appearance.

Installation Requirements

Before buying, I always check how difficult the installation will be. Some hoods with scoops are bolt-on and straightforward, while others may need cutting, drilling, or professional fitting. I prefer products that come with clear instructions and mounting hardware. If the installation seems complicated, I factor in the cost of professional help.

Paint and Finish

I look at whether the hood comes painted, primed, or unfinished. A finished hood saves me time, but I still make sure the color and gloss level match my vehicle. If it comes unfinished, I plan for painting costs before making a purchase. I also check whether the finish is resistant to fading, chipping, and weather damage.

Performance Considerations

If I want performance benefits, I look at how the scoop is designed to work with airflow. Some scoops help feed cooler air to the intake, which can be useful in certain applications. I also make sure the hood does not interfere with engine components or create unwanted turbulence. For me, performance only matters if the design actually supports it.

Budget and Value

I set my budget before I start comparing options. Hood with hood scoop products can vary a lot in price depending on material, brand, and finish. I try to balance cost with quality so I do not end up replacing the hood later. In my experience, the cheapest option is not always the best value.

Brand Reputation and Reviews

I always read customer reviews before I buy. Reviews help me learn about fitment, finish quality, and installation issues from real users. I also prefer brands with a good reputation for durability and customer support. A trusted brand gives me more confidence that I am making the right choice.
